Publication number: 20110106712Abstract: Cost aware service aggregation is described; for example, two or more web services may be connected to form an aggregate service in a way which minimizes computational costs and/or costs of network resources between the services. In an embodiment a service has a two or more contracts expressed using process-algebra which capture data representations and protocols of the web service. In an embodiment, a static analysis engine identifies combinations of contracts which are compatible according to the process-algebra. In an example, the identified combinations of contracts are ranked by cost to select an optimal combination. In other examples, network environment conditions are taken into account and dynamic adjustments made to the aggregation. Patent number: 7933794Abstract: A method and system for ADI (Active Dependency Integration) provides an information and execution model for the description of enterprise systems, solutions and services. It supports the modeling of various entities and business components (e.g. event, disk, application, activity, business process), the information that is associated with them (i.e. schema), and the semantic relationships among them (e.g. dependency between a business component and other business components and events). The ADI execution model monitors and manages business components and the relationships among them. Patent number: 7848359Abstract: A system for executing distributed software under hard real-time conditions comprises a plurality of nodes and a communication channel. Nodes are allowed to transmit data across the communication channel within time windows relative to repetitive communication time intervals of the communication channel, wherein a number of bytes transmitted within the communication time windows may vary from communication time window to communication time window. The data may be transmitted as a message comprising a representation of an identifying tag and a representation of the data. Publication number: 20100306004Abstract: A computing system causes a plurality of display devices to display user interfaces containing portions of a canvas shared by a plurality of users. The canvas is a graphical space containing discrete graphical elements located at arbitrary locations within the canvas. Each of the discrete graphical elements graphically represents a discrete resource. When a user interacts with a resource in the set of resources, the computing system modifies the canvas to include an interaction element indicating that the user is interacting with the resource. The computer system then causes the display devices to update the user interfaces such that the user interfaces reflect a substantially current state of the canvas. Patent number: 7779444Abstract: A video on request (“VOR”) system is disclosed. The VOR system includes a producer having a location device for providing location data and a video recording device. The VOR system also includes an information exchange having a producer database configured to store a producer profile having current location and status of the producer. The current location and status are continually updated based on the location data. The VOR system also includes a viewer having access to the information exchange to search the producer database for available producers within a predetermined range of a desired location. Upon finding the available producer at the desired location, the viewer requests an information segment to be produced by the producer from the desired location.
